Abstract
A method for inducing a mucosal immunity with production of secretory IgA antibodies that neutralize of block a native E7 protein originating from cancerous cells, from cells infected by a human Papillomavirus or from an immune system cell. The method includes administering to a patient in need thereof, a vaccine composition containing an active compound which is the native E7 protein, the properties of which have been inactivated by at least 70% by a physical and/or a chemical treatment, by genetic recombination or by adjuvant conditions; an inactive fragment of the immunosuppressive and/or angiogenic native E7 protein; a DNA molecule encoding the immunosuppressive and/or angiogenic native E7 protein inactivated by at least 70% by mutation; or a DNA molecule encoding an inactive fragment of the immunosuppressive and/or angiogenic native E7 protein; along with an adjuvant of mucosal immunity.
